On Sunday 05 February 2006 23:04, Daniel Chojecki wrote: > What should be done next to complite ACL installation ? What patches > should be applied to coreutils source ? Either use the current cvs version of coreutils which has acl support built in, or the coreutils patches from OpenSuSE, http://ftp.opensuse.org/pub/opensuse/distribution/ SL-OSS-factory/inst-source/suse/src/coreutils-5.93-8.src.rpm Note that the coreutils cvs doesn't have xattr support; if you want cp and mv to preserve xattrs as well, use the OpenSUSE patch.
